MDT tubes time spectra 1 tdc count = 0.78 ns Trigger window = 1.6 ms 168000 triggers collected 2 hits in 156 ns nNOISE~ 75 Hz ( tdc counts ) 12 hits in 156 ns nNOISE~ 460 Hz ( tdc counts ) trigger-related noise 98 hits in 156 ns nNOISE~ 3.7 kHz The high noise level is caused by non proper grounding connections ( tdc counts )

With a more accurate grounding connections (ground pins and screws on the ground plates) the situation has improved 1 tdc count = 0.78 ns Trigger window = 1.6 ms 63000 triggers collected 0 hits in 156 ns nNOISE~ 0 Hz ( tdc counts ) 2 hits in 156 ns nNOISE~ 200 Hz ( tdc counts ) 1 hit in 156 ns nNOISE~ 100 Hz The different lenght in the time spactra is dued to the gas flow-meter miscalibration ( tdc counts )
